Jenkins user
61729b9e00
[maven-release-plugin] prepare release v0.10.0.Beta1
2019-06-11 11:20:46 +00:00
Chris Cranford
0aadaa10dc
DBZ-1242 Fixed typo and added negative test checks
2019-06-05 13:31:25 -04:00
Jenkins user
056730d06a
[maven-release-plugin] prepare for next development iteration
2019-06-03 10:24:08 +00:00
Jenkins user
7aeaec236e
[maven-release-plugin] prepare release v0.10.0.Alpha2
2019-06-03 10:24:08 +00:00
Jenkins user
ac5c76e431
[maven-release-plugin] prepare for next development iteration
2019-05-28 14:38:32 +00:00
Jenkins user
35f59ba460
[maven-release-plugin] prepare release v0.10.0.Alpha1
2019-05-28 14:38:32 +00:00
Jenkins user
7748be6056
[maven-release-plugin] prepare for next development iteration
2019-05-02 16:04:56 +00:00
Jenkins user
5af083b86e
[maven-release-plugin] prepare release v0.9.5.Final
2019-05-02 16:04:55 +00:00
jcechace
74e7fc8325
[jenkins-jobs] Removed @Override annotation when implementing SourceTaskContext#configs(); for compatibility with Kafka 1.x APIs
2019-04-17 17:26:39 +02:00
Jenkins user
cefc5ccfb9
[maven-release-plugin] prepare for next development iteration
2019-04-11 12:07:16 +00:00
Jenkins user
fc3026adc3
[maven-release-plugin] prepare release v0.9.4.Final
2019-04-11 12:07:15 +00:00
jchipmunk
7c0ae3ee20
DBZ-1212 SLF4J usage issues
2019-04-04 21:32:12 +02:00
ShubhamRwt
540a951211
DBZ- 362 Adding WhitespaceAfter check to Checkstyle
2019-03-28 09:24:11 +01:00
Jenkins user
8b0edd1871
[maven-release-plugin] prepare for next development iteration
2019-03-25 12:16:31 +00:00
Jenkins user
56f98a48b2
[maven-release-plugin] prepare release v0.9.3.Final
2019-03-25 12:16:30 +00:00
shubham
8cca21e969
DBZ-1039 Make all ifs with braces
2019-03-25 10:23:14 +01:00
Addison Higham
8e21139ca3
DBZ-1082 Add new custom recovery mode, more metadata
...
This commit does a few things:
- Refactors snapshot modes to be encapsulated by an interface and
to only use that interface in determining when to snapshot and in
determing the type of the `RecordProducer` interface to instantiate
- Refactors the configuration of existing snapshot modes to tie the
existing snapshot modes to their aligned implementation
- Adds a new snapshot.mode, custom, and a new configuration option to
specify a custom implementation that will be loaded by the class loader
- Changes the visibility of some classes to allow for custom snapshot
modes to get enough context to make an informed choice
- Adds some metadata about slots (the catalog_xmin) to give a full idea
of the state of slots which can be useful in implementing snapshot
modes (which is also configurable, as it can add some overhead)
Together, these changes allow for a much broader flexibility got end
users to implement a snapshot mode that can do more advanced snapshots,
such as partial recovery or for partial snapshots for tables where not
all records are needed.
This could also be seen as superseeding the
`snapshot.select.statement.overrides` to allow for users to dynamically
build queries based on the state of the slot and the offsets consumed.
2019-03-24 11:56:40 +01:00
Jenkins user
50a7c568fa
[maven-release-plugin] prepare for next development iteration
2019-02-23 09:53:58 +00:00
Jenkins user
28f3839804
[maven-release-plugin] prepare release v0.9.2.Final
2019-02-23 09:53:58 +00:00
Jenkins user
b96e5fee0d
[maven-release-plugin] prepare for next development iteration
2019-02-13 11:13:44 +00:00
Jenkins user
3de2d04bcd
[maven-release-plugin] prepare release v0.9.1.Final
2019-02-13 11:13:44 +00:00
jchipmunk
ff4e38cc46
DBZ-1112 Strings.join() doesn't apply conversation for first element
...
Replace:
- Integer.parseInt() to Integer.valueOf()
- Short.parseShort() and new Short() to Short.valueOf()
- Long.parseLong() to Long.valueOf()
2019-01-30 09:36:09 +01:00
Jenkins user
c5b7d21d3e
[maven-release-plugin] prepare for next development iteration
2019-01-28 11:07:04 +00:00
Jenkins user
f1ae79ff73
[maven-release-plugin] prepare release v0.9.0.CR1
2019-01-28 11:07:04 +00:00
Jiri Pechanec
32f9543979
DBZ-1103 Make pause before interrupt configurable
2019-01-28 11:07:34 +01:00
Jiri Pechanec
3bd97d3bd7
DBZ-1103 Wait for completion before interrupt
2019-01-25 21:27:06 +01:00
Jiri Pechanec
80334ea14a
DBZ-1101 Increase wait times for shutdown
2019-01-25 21:27:06 +01:00
Gunnar Morling
54b47e5205
DBZ-1080 Exception clarification
2019-01-18 14:06:50 +01:00
Gunnar Morling
4522b84c13
DBZ-1080 Some clean-up;
...
* JavaDoc
* Improved method signature
2019-01-18 14:06:50 +01:00
Gunnar Morling
58366fc5f3
DBZ-1080 Some clean-up
2019-01-18 14:06:50 +01:00
Addison Higham
26f836e0f6
DBZ-1080 new API for EmbeddedEngine for batch/async
...
This introduces a new API to the EmbeddedEngine, the ChangeConsumer,
which gives the user a more flexible option for consuming changes by
exposing groups of records as well as the ability to control the
comitting of those records.
This remainds completely backwards compatible with the old API as the
ChangeConsumer wraps the existing Consumer interface with a default
implementation.
2019-01-18 14:06:50 +01:00
Jenkins user
5275f73424
[maven-release-plugin] prepare for next development iteration
2018-12-19 13:06:12 +00:00
Jenkins user
b6569c18ae
[maven-release-plugin] prepare release v0.9.0.Beta2
2018-12-19 13:06:12 +00:00
Jiri Pechanec
80732a1094
DBZ-1037 Making embedded engine compileable with Kafka 1.x
2018-12-13 12:31:54 +01:00
Jenkins user
db1d3a7fb8
[maven-release-plugin] prepare for next development iteration
2018-11-20 16:15:14 +00:00
Jenkins user
f83db82cea
[maven-release-plugin] prepare release v0.9.0.Beta1
2018-11-20 16:15:14 +00:00
Gunnar Morling
19becc4122
DBZ-776 Typo fix
2018-11-16 14:21:39 +01:00
Jenkins user
d952f5dfb0
[maven-release-plugin] prepare for next development iteration
2018-10-04 11:59:14 +00:00
Jenkins user
ff9b70278b
[maven-release-plugin] prepare release v0.9.0.Alpha2
2018-10-04 11:59:13 +00:00
Jiri Pechanec
9d904a1150
DBZ-858 Upgrade to Kafka 2.0.0
2018-08-20 15:56:23 +02:00
Jenkins user
e00dad127f
[maven-release-plugin] prepare for next development iteration
2018-07-26 08:00:12 +00:00
Jenkins user
16bfd5c700
[maven-release-plugin] prepare release v0.9.0.Alpha1
2018-07-26 08:00:12 +00:00
Jiri Pechanec
f118e37da0
DBZ-40 Changes to support SQL Server connector
2018-07-13 22:23:00 +02:00
Jenkins user
f9b8d830a8
[maven-release-plugin] prepare for next development iteration
2018-07-11 07:36:30 +00:00
Jenkins user
290ded678f
[maven-release-plugin] prepare release v0.8.0.Final
2018-07-11 07:36:29 +00:00
Jenkins user
033db6659d
[maven-release-plugin] prepare for next development iteration
2018-07-04 07:07:44 +00:00
Jenkins user
696f35f2c0
[maven-release-plugin] prepare release v0.8.0.CR1
2018-07-04 07:07:44 +00:00
Gunnar Morling
bf7a5018ca
Setting POM version back to 0.8.0-SNAPSHOT
2018-06-22 12:21:03 +02:00
Jenkins user
db42e4657a
[maven-release-plugin] prepare for next development iteration
2018-06-21 14:07:45 +00:00
Jenkins user
c4b8ecaa99
[maven-release-plugin] prepare release v0.8.0.Beta1
2018-06-21 14:07:45 +00:00
Jiri Pechanec
b23a1ecd96
DBZ-20 Restore default test timeout
2018-06-20 13:05:37 +02:00
Gunnar Morling
f4e3668ebf
DBZ-20 Tune up timeouts/connector/oracle/OracleStreamingChangeEventSource.java
2018-06-20 13:05:37 +02:00
Jiri Pechanec
10ddb69dea
DBZ-20 A subset of string, time and number datatypes
2018-06-20 13:05:37 +02:00
Gunnar Morling
d7e196a18e
DBZ-20 Initial import of Oracle connector based on XStream
2018-06-20 13:05:37 +02:00
Jiri Pechanec
9580c8c290
DBZ-252 Rebase to master
2018-06-15 11:42:24 +02:00
Stephen Powis
867202e0ca
DBZ-706 Slight refactoring / shuffling of code to validate source query field in snapshot tests
2018-06-01 11:23:12 +02:00
Stephen Powis
cc33fed16a
DBZ-706 Adding option for showing source query in sourceInfo element
2018-06-01 11:23:12 +02:00
Jenkins user
f4e151b23a
[maven-release-plugin] prepare for next development iteration
2018-03-20 08:14:19 +00:00
Jenkins user
93b3252332
[maven-release-plugin] prepare release v0.7.5
2018-03-20 08:14:19 +00:00
Andrew Tongen
2792f4cac3
DBZ-665 Passing correct value for timeSinceLastCommit to commit offset policy
2018-03-19 12:23:18 +01:00
Jenkins user
daf27207be
[maven-release-plugin] prepare for next development iteration
2018-03-07 08:31:07 +00:00
Jenkins user
9c73774928
[maven-release-plugin] prepare release v0.7.4
2018-03-07 08:31:07 +00:00
Jenkins user
6d0cd88e12
[maven-release-plugin] prepare for next development iteration
2018-02-15 04:15:34 +00:00
Jenkins user
7d1e1a989e
[maven-release-plugin] prepare release v0.7.3
2018-02-15 04:15:34 +00:00
Gunnar Morling
2a724d9611
DBZ-537 Misc. adjustments:
...
* Renaming ConfigurationHelper to Instantiator
* Doc improvements and typo fixes
* Bringing getInstance() methods into consistent order
* Raising exception instead of logging error if instantion fails
2018-02-09 15:45:57 +01:00
Jiri Pechanec
5be55ae8ff
DBZ-537 OffsetCommitPolicy supports Configuration constructor initialization
2018-02-09 15:19:48 +01:00
Jiri Pechanec
a8750221cb
DBZ-537 OffsetCommitPolicy is configurable via builder
2018-02-09 15:19:48 +01:00
Jiri Pechanec
eb7cc3f28e
DBZ-537 Change OffsetCommitPolicy to use Duration in API
2018-02-09 15:19:48 +01:00
Jiri Pechanec
8c3daa387d
DBZ-537 Move OffsetCommitPolicy to SPI
2018-02-09 15:19:48 +01:00
Jiri Pechanec
452f9af52d
DBZ-537 Configurable offset commit strategy
2018-02-09 15:19:48 +01:00
Jiri Pechanec
9b592204ac
DBZ-587 Centralize and unify thread management
2018-02-01 10:04:20 +01:00
Jenkins user
04624341f5
[maven-release-plugin] prepare for next development iteration
2018-01-25 09:39:44 +00:00
Jenkins user
898f6884e1
[maven-release-plugin] prepare release v0.7.2
2018-01-25 09:39:44 +00:00
Gunnar Morling
1bc9dec6f5
DBZ-555 Adding Denis Mikhaylov to COPYRIGHT.txt; formatting
2018-01-19 12:30:26 +01:00
Denis Mikhaylov
048f1323cd
DBZ-555 Add missing config fields to EmbeddedEngine
2018-01-19 12:30:17 +01:00
Jenkins user
6bb34b42f9
[maven-release-plugin] prepare for next development iteration
2017-12-20 07:15:12 +00:00
Jenkins user
16dcd4c980
[maven-release-plugin] prepare release v0.7.1
2017-12-20 07:15:12 +00:00
Jenkins user
5e09932cb9
[maven-release-plugin] prepare for next development iteration
2017-12-15 05:10:23 +00:00
Jenkins user
6c1d61e03b
[maven-release-plugin] prepare release v0.7.0
2017-12-15 05:10:23 +00:00
Jiri Pechanec
196f6b3571
DBZ-406 Fixing test, adding warning for disabled rollback
2017-12-13 14:12:27 +01:00
Gunnar Morling
5fbe742be8
DBZ-285 Specifying scope of dependencies in the individual POMs for the sake of comprehensibility
2017-11-10 16:48:32 +01:00
Ben Williams
a3b4fedd5f
DBZ-363 Add support for BIGINT UNSIGNED handling for MySQL
2017-10-18 10:20:03 +02:00
Jiri Pechanec
0bc8129961
DBZ-258 Support for wal2json plugin
2017-10-18 09:21:22 +02:00
Jenkins user
75937711fa
[maven-release-plugin] prepare for next development iteration
2017-09-21 04:42:02 +00:00
Jenkins user
a89b9332e4
[maven-release-plugin] prepare release v0.6.0
2017-09-21 04:42:02 +00:00
Jenkins user
214696ef0c
[maven-release-plugin] prepare for next development iteration
2017-08-17 11:51:05 +00:00
Jenkins user
c867e6fea6
[maven-release-plugin] prepare release v0.5.2
2017-08-17 11:51:05 +00:00
Gunnar Morling
a8d1817c22
[maven-release-plugin] prepare for next development iteration
2017-06-09 16:14:31 +00:00
Gunnar Morling
3f512aace7
[maven-release-plugin] prepare release v0.5.1
2017-06-09 16:14:31 +00:00
Randall Hauch
709cd8f3fe
[maven-release-plugin] prepare for next development iteration
2017-03-27 11:28:12 -05:00
Randall Hauch
2bc3d45954
[maven-release-plugin] prepare release v0.5.0
2017-03-27 11:28:11 -05:00
Randall Hauch
430d756062
[maven-release-plugin] prepare for next development iteration
2017-03-17 15:41:58 -05:00
Randall Hauch
536cbf6300
[maven-release-plugin] prepare release v0.4.1
2017-03-17 15:41:57 -05:00
Randall Hauch
8c60c29883
[maven-release-plugin] prepare for next development iteration
2017-02-07 14:22:12 -06:00
Randall Hauch
20134286e9
[maven-release-plugin] prepare release v0.4.0
2017-02-07 14:22:11 -06:00
Randall Hauch
fe17b246af
DBZ-113 Added MySQL threads to the event’s source metadata
...
Changed the events’ `source` structure to optionally contain the identifier of the MySQL thread where appropriate. The thread is included on each `BEGIN` binlog event, so these are captured and added to all of the associated change events produced for that transaction.
2017-02-02 11:53:32 -06:00
Horia Chiorean
d035c4bc8d
DBZ-173 Changes the MySQL ITs to not use TZ information for expected dates and fixes the character set for parsing test files
2017-01-27 14:53:10 +02:00
Horia Chiorean
a2154d3d32
DBZ-173 Changes the MySQL ITs to use the database.hostname system property instead of always hardcoding 'localhost'
2017-01-27 09:19:57 +02:00
Horia Chiorean
7dfdef3558
DBZ-173 Upgrades the Kafka artifact versions to 0.10.1.1
2017-01-27 09:19:57 +02:00
Randall Hauch
e8b06b0ec1
Merge pull request #144 from hchiorean/DBZ-3
...
DBZ-3 Implements a Debezium Connector for ingesting Postgresql changes via logical decoding
2017-01-11 13:32:09 -06:00